Best Tips For Choosing Chicken Breeds

When choosing chicken breeds, there are a few things to consider, such as your climate, your needs, and your budget.

Chicken Breeds

Cold-hardy breeds are a good choice for colder climates, while heat-tolerant breeds are a good choice for warmer climates.

Climate

Think about what you need from your chickens. Do you want them for eggs, meat, or both? Do you want them to be friendly and docile, or do you want them to be more independent?

Needs

Chickens can be a relatively inexpensive hobby, but there are some costs associated with raising them, such as coops, feeders, and waterers.

Budget

Some of the most popular breeds for backyard flocks include: Australorp, Barred Plymouth Rock, Buff Orpington, Rhode Island Red and Wyandotte.

Popular Breeds

Chickens can be found at most feed stores or online. When choosing chickens, be sure to get them from a reputable source.

Finding Chicken Breeds

By considering your climate, your needs, and your budget, you can find the perfect breeds for your home.
